    This is a mega-change to support Linux guest WSI with gfxstream.
    We tried to do a branch where every commit was buildable and
    runnable, but that quickly proved unworkable. So we squashed
    the branch into a mega-change.
    
    Zink provides the GL implementation for Linux guests, so we just
    needed to implement the proper Vulkan Wayland/X11 WSI
    entrypoints.
    
    The overall strategy to support this is to use Mesa's WSI
    functions.  The Vulkan WSI layer was also considered:
    
    https://gitlab.freedesktop.org/mesa/vulkan-wsi-layer
    
    But it was less maintained compared to Mesa.  The way Mesa common
    layers communicate with drivers is the through base objects
    embedded in driver and a common dispatch layer:
    
    https://gitlab.freedesktop.org/mesa/mesa/-/blob/main/docs/vulkan/dispatch.rst
    https://gitlab.freedesktop.org/mesa/mesa/-/blob/main/docs/vulkan/base-objs.rst
    
    Our objects are defined in gfxstream_vk_private.h.  Currently,
    Mesa-derived Vulkan objects just serve as shim to gfxstream
    Vulkan’s internal handle mapping. Long-term, we can use
    Mesa-derived objects inside gfxstream guest Vulkan exclusively.
    
    The flow is typically inside a Vulkan entrypoint is:
    
    - VK_FROM_HANDLE(vk-object) to convert to a gfxstream_vk_obj
      object
    - Call ResourceTracker::func(gfxstream_vk_obj->internal) or
      VkEncoder::func(gfxstream_vk_obj>internal)
    - Return result
    
    A good follow-up cleanup would be to delete older gfxstream
    objects.  For example, we now have struct gfxstream_vk_device
    and info_VkDevice in ResourceTracker.
    
    Most of this logic was auto-generated and included in
    func_table.cpp. Some vulkan functions were too difficult to
    auto-generate or required special logic, and these are included
    in gfxstream_vk_device.cpp.  For example, anything that needs to
    setup the HostConnection requires special handling.
    
    Android Blueprint support is added to the parts of Mesa needed
    to build the Vulkan runtime.  One thing to call out it's
    required to build the guest/vulkan_enc and guest/vulkan files
    in the same shared library now, when previously have
    libvulkan_enc.so and libvulkan_ranchu.so was sufficient
    [otherwise, some weak pointer logic wouldn't work].
    
    A side effect of this is libOpenglSystem must also be a static
    lib, and so should libandroid_aemu too.  That conceptually makes
    sense and the Meson build had been doing this all a long.  We
    can probably transition everything besides libGLESv1_emulation.so,
    libGLESv2_emulation.so and libvulkan_ranchu.so to be static.
    
    This requires changes in the end2end tests, because since each
    HostConnection is separate and internal to it's constituent
    library. Lifetimes need to be managed separately: for example
    the HostConnection instance created by the end2end tests would
    not be visible inside libvulkan_ranchu.so anymore. Probably the
    best solution would be improve the testing facade so a
    HostConnection represents one virtio-gpu context, while some
    other entity represents a virtio-gpu device (client-server
    would work).
    
    vk.xml was modified, but change sent to Khronos:
    
    https://gitlab.khronos.org/vulkan/vulkan/-/merge_requests/6325
    
    Fuchsia builds still need to be migrated, but they already have
    Fuchsia Mesa with all the build rules so that shouldn't be too
    bad. Just need to copy them over the gfxstream/Mesa hybrid.
    
    The new command for building Linux guests is:
    
    meson amd64-build/ -Dvulkan-drivers="gfxstream" -Dgallium-drivers="" -Dvk-no-nir=true -Dopengl=false
